Transaction 98085ecb08a4e56c8943f31d19e8b52d4219b0427795f597b4b7fc9ab4fef64a

1 Input
2 Outputs
  • 98085ecb08a4e56c8943f31d19e8b52d4219b0427795f597b4b7fc9ab4fef64a:0
  • value  36000
    address  3MjiaCgemfFYR9v44J3ed5CjEEC2wGJWB9
  • 98085ecb08a4e56c8943f31d19e8b52d4219b0427795f597b4b7fc9ab4fef64a:1
  • value  59937
    address  33hEXAtRss61Puz8A26Gnst6QvJEuiohyQ